Edgar Viltsans is a music producer, arranger, composer, and jazz pianist. He worked at Ukraine’s largest record label, MOZGI, collaborating with top artists like Potap, Nastya Kamenski, and Nadia Dorofeeva. Mr. Viltsans also performed with renowned jazz saxophonist Kenta Igarashi and served as a producer, pianist, and co-writer for legendary singer Petro Chorniy. Edgar holds a bachelor’s degree in jazz piano from the Glière Academy of Music in Kyiv.
Now based in Europe, he has made a name in the industry, working with Universal Latvia and collaborating with top musicians. In 2022, he became a DJ and on-air personality for Latvian Radio’s “Dod Pieci”, helping raise over €896,000 for charity.
His partnership with Katrina Gupalo has led to performances at major venues across Europe and the Middle East, as well as hit songs like “Dur Prom”, which spent 13 weeks in Latvia’s Top 10, and “The Cat’s Song”, which placed third in the 2024 Latvian Eurovision Competition. He also produced music for Latvia’s “Воля” silver coin collection and Gertrudes Street Theater.In 2023, Edgar produced music for four of the 15 accepted songs in the Latvian National Eurovision competition “Supernova 2024.”
